History and Artisan Approach

Founded by chocolatier Ginger Elizabeth Hahn, the business began as a small operation focused on reviving traditional chocolate-making techniques with contemporary creativity. What started as a passion project has evolved into one of Sacramento's most respected artisan food establishments, maintaining a commitment to small-batch production that ensures quality control and freshness.

The chocolatier's background in fine arts influences the visual presentation of each piece, while her culinary training informs the sophisticated flavor profiles that have become signature to ginger elizabeth chocolates sacramento. Unlike mass-produced alternatives, each chocolate is crafted with attention to texture, temperature, and flavor balance that reflects true artisan dedication.

Signature Products and Menu Highlights

Ginger Elizabeth Chocolates distinguishes itself through its rotating selection of seasonal offerings alongside permanent favorites. The ginger elizabeth chocolates menu sacramento features:

  • Single-origin chocolate bars - Sourced from ethical producers worldwide
  • Hand-painted chocolate bonbons - Featuring creative combinations like yuzu-ginger and lavender-honey
  • Seasonal collections - Updated quarterly to incorporate fresh, local ingredients
  • Chocolate tasting experiences - Guided explorations of flavor profiles and production methods

Unlike standard chocolate shops in the area, Ginger Elizabeth emphasizes the terroir of cacao beans, much like wine connoisseurs appreciate grape varietals.
